Roof Replacement Cost Guide for Depoe Bay, Oregon

Typical installed range — full replacement
$4,800 – $20,000

A full roof replacement in Depoe Bay typically runs $4,800 – $20,000 installed — $350 – $900 per square (100 sq ft) — including tear-off, permits, and local labor.

Roofing cost by material.

Installed price ranges for a full roof replacement in Depoe Bay, adjusted for local labor and code. Linked materials have a dedicated city guide.

  • Architectural shingle roof
    Dimensional laminated shingles — the U.S. default
    $6,400 – $13,000
  • 3-tab shingle roof
    Entry-level asphalt
    $4,800 – $8,400
  • Standing-seam metal roof
    Concealed fasteners, 40–70 year service life
    $12,000 – $32,000
  • Corrugated metal roof
    Exposed-fastener panels
    $6,400 – $16,000
  • Flat roof membrane
    TPO, EPDM, or PVC for low-slope sections
    $4,000 – $12,000
  • Tear-off & disposal
    Removing the old roof, dumpster included
    $800 – $2,400
  • Permits & inspection
    Varies by municipality
    $200 – $800

* Ranges adjusted for Depoe Bay's tier and median income — verify with an on-site quote.

Before you sign: the quote checklist

  • Get quotes from at least 3 licensed roofing contractors in Depoe Bay.
  • Make sure every quote itemizes tear-off, underlayment, flashing, and disposal.
  • Verify licensing and insurance before hiring — ask for certificates, not promises.
  • Ask about both the material warranty and the workmanship warranty — they differ.

Cost factors

Why Roof Replacement Costs Vary in Depoe Bay

Several local factors drive cost differences. Depoe Bay's coastal climate means roofs must resist wind-driven rain and salt corrosion, often requiring higher-grade materials like asphalt shingles with enhanced wind ratings or metal roofing. The age of the housing stock matters: older homes may need structural updates to meet Oregon's current building code, adding to labor time. Steep roof pitches common in oceanfront properties increase safety requirements and installation complexity. Disposal fees for old roofing materials can be higher due to limited local landfill options. Permitting through the city's office adds a small cost but ensures code compliance. Labor availability also plays a role, as skilled roofers are in demand along the coast.

Field notes

Common Issues

  1. Wind Damage

    Strong coastal winds can lift and tear shingles, especially on older roofs with worn adhesive. Repeated wind exposure leads to granule loss and eventual failure.

  2. Moisture and Moss Growth

    Depoe Bay's damp climate encourages moss and algae growth, which traps moisture against shingles and accelerates decay. This can lead to rot and leaks over time.

  3. Salt Air Corrosion

    Salt-laden air from the ocean corrodes metal flashings and fasteners, compromising the roof's integrity. This is a common reason for premature replacement in coastal homes.

  4. UV Degradation

    Even in a cloudy climate, UV rays break down asphalt shingles over time, causing cracking and brittleness. This is accelerated in south-facing exposures.

  5. Rain and Leak History

    Persistent rain can exploit small weaknesses, leading to chronic leaks. Homes with multiple leak repairs often reach a point where full replacement is more practical.

Roof Replacement cost questions — Depoe Bay

What factors affect roof replacement cost in Depoe Bay?

Costs depend on roof size, pitch, material choice, and accessibility. Local climate considerations like wind and moisture may require upgraded materials. Labor rates reflect coastal demand, and permit fees from the city add a small amount. Disposal costs for old materials also vary.

How do I choose a roofing contractor in Depoe Bay?

Look for contractors licensed with the Oregon Construction Contractors Board (CCB). Ask for references from local jobs, especially coastal homes. Verify insurance and check for any complaints. A contractor familiar with Depoe Bay's climate will understand material and installation requirements.

What are Oregon's licensing requirements for roofers?

Oregon requires roofers to hold a valid CCB license. This ensures they meet state bonding and insurance requirements. Always verify a contractor's license number before hiring. Local building departments may also require permits for replacement work.

When is the ideal time for roof replacement in Depoe Bay?

Late spring through early fall offers the most reliable weather for installation. Summer months provide longer dry windows, though coastal fog can still occur. Scheduling ahead is recommended, as demand peaks during this period.

Do I need a permit for roof replacement in Depoe Bay?

Yes, most roof replacements require a permit from the city's permitting office. The permit ensures work meets Oregon's building code. Your contractor typically handles this, but confirm it's included in the scope of work.
